Browse Source

资源发布修改

jack 7 years ago
parent
commit
dff93daf45
2 changed files with 40 additions and 29 deletions
  1. 39 28
      js/resourceIssue.js
  2. 1 1
      resourceIssue.html

+ 39 - 28
js/resourceIssue.js

@ -205,7 +205,7 @@ $(document).ready(function() {
205 205
	/*关键词*/
206 206
	$("#keywordName").bind({
207 207
		focus: function() {
208
			$("#keywordPrompt").show().text('最多可添加5个关键词每个关键词最多10个字');
208
			$("#keywordPrompt").show().text('最多可添加5个关键词每个关键词10字以内');
209 209
			$("#keyList").show();
210 210
		},
211 211
		blur: function() {
@ -215,49 +215,56 @@ $(document).ready(function() {
215 215
			},200)
216 216
		},
217 217
		keyup: function() {
218
			if($(this).val().length > 10) {
218
			var lNum=$.trim($(this).val()).length;
219
			console.log(lNum);
220
			if(lNum > 10) {
219 221
				$(this).val($(this).val().substr(0, 10));
220
			} else if(0 < $(this).val().length < 10) {
221
					$.ajax({
222
					"url": "/ajax/dataDict/qaHotKey",
223
					"type": "GET",
224
					"success": function(data) {
225
						console.log(data);
226
						if(data.success) {
227
							if(data.data.length==0) {
228
								$("#keyList ul").html("");
229
							}else{
230
								var oSr="";
231
								for(var i=0;i<data.data.length;i++) {
232
									oSr+='<li><p class="h2Font">'+data.data[i].caption+'</p></li>'
222
			} else if(0 < lNum&& lNum < 10) {
223
					$("#addKeyword").show();
224
						$.ajax({
225
						"url": "/ajax/dataDict/qaHotKey",
226
						"type": "GET",
227
						"success": function(data) {
228
							console.log(data);
229
							if(data.success) {
230
								if(data.data.length==0) {
231
									$("#keyList ul").html("");
232
								}else{
233
									var oSr="";
234
									for(var i=0;i<data.data.length;i++) {
235
										oSr+='<li><p class="h2Font">'+data.data[i].caption+'</p></li>'
236
									}
237
									$("#keyList ul").html(oSr);
233 238
								}
234
								$("#keyList ul").html(oSr);
239
							}else {
240
								$("#keyList ul").html("");
235 241
							}
236
						}else {
237
							$("#keyList ul").html("");
242
						},
243
						"data": {
244
							"key":$(this).val()
245
						},
246
						dataType: "json",
247
						'error':function() {
248
							$.MsgBox.Alert('提示', '服务器连接超时!');
238 249
						}
239
					},
240
					"data": {
241
						"key":$(this).val()
242
					},
243
					dataType: "json",
244
					'error':function() {
245
						$.MsgBox.Alert('提示', '服务器连接超时!');
246
					}
247
			});
250
				});
251
			}else if(lNum == 0){
252
				 $("#addKeyword").hide();
253
				 $("#keyList ul").html("");
248 254
			}
249 255
		}
250 256
	});
251 257
	$("#keyList ul").on("click","li",function(){
252 258
		 keyWord($(this).find("p").text());
253 259
		 $("#keyList ul").html("");
260
		 $("#addKeyword").hide();
254 261
	})
255 262
	/*添加关键词*/
256 263
	$("#addKeyword").click(function() {
257 264
		 keyWord($("#keywordName").val());
258 265
	})
259 266
	function keyWord(atl) {
260
		var oKeywordName = atl;
267
		var oKeywordName =  $.trim(atl);
261 268
		var keywordListLength = $("#keywordList").find("li");
262 269
		if(oKeywordName.length == 0) {
263 270
			$("#keywordPrompt").text('关键词输入不能为空');
@ -269,11 +276,14 @@ $(document).ready(function() {
269 276
				return;
270 277
			}
271 278
		}
279
		 $("#keyList ul").html("");
280
		  $("#addKeyword").hide();
272 281
		var oStr = '<li><p class="h2Font">' + oKeywordName + '</p><div class="closeThis"></div></li>'
273 282
		$("#keywordList").append(oStr);
274 283
		$("#keywordName").val("");
275 284
		if((keywordListLength.length + 1) == 5) {
276 285
			$("#keywordHide").hide();
286
			$("#keyList").css("border-top","none");
277 287
		}
278 288
	}
279 289
	/*删除关键词*/
@ -282,6 +292,7 @@ $(document).ready(function() {
282 292
		var keywordListLength = $("#keywordList").find("li");
283 293
		if(keywordListLength.length < 5) {
284 294
			$("#keywordHide").show();
295
			$(".#keyList").css("border-top","1px solid #E5E5E5");		
285 296
		}
286 297
	});
287 298
	/*应用用途*/

+ 1 - 1
resourceIssue.html

@ -53,7 +53,7 @@
53 53
						<div style="position: relative;" id="keywordHide">
54 54
							<input type="text" class="frmtype frmcontype" id="keywordName" value="" placeholder="请输入关键词" />
55 55
							<!--输入框中键入内容时按钮显示,添加内容出现在结果标签中时按钮隐藏-->
56
							<button class="frmcontype frmadd" id="addKeyword">添加</button>
56
							<button class="frmcontype frmadd displayNone" id="addKeyword">添加</button>
57 57
						</div>
58 58
						<div class="form-drop keydrop displayNone"  id="keyList">
59 59
							<ul>